Multimatic Motorsports Europe (in conjunction with The Heart of Racing) is expanding its team to continue to develop and race the Aston Martin LMH Hypercar

Position Overview:

Multimatic Motorsports Europe is currently seeking to recruit an experienced Composites Technician

Reporting to the head of Composites, the successful applicant will assume responsibility of carbon fibre bodywork tasks to prepare Endurance racing cars to the highest professional standards.

Key Responsibilities Composite Repair:
  • Repair, finish, and maintain high-performance carbon fibre components to the highest standards for endurance racing applications.
  • Carry out structural and cosmetic composite repairs, including bonded joints, inserts, and crash damage repairs.
  • Composite repair preparation, Wet lay laminating, vacuum bagging, trimming, drilling, profiling, fitting, and finishing of components to engineering drawings and build specifications.
  • Ensure all components meet required dimensional, structural, and safety standards prior to sign-off.
Car Build & Trackside Support:
  • Support the Race team composite department through the assembly process of composite assemblies through to final fitment on the race car.
  • Work closely with mechanics, engineers, and build teams to ensure optimal fit, alignment, and functionality of all components.
  • Carry out fast and effective trackside composite repairs and turnaround work under high-pressure race and test conditions.
  • Contribute to problem-solving and continuous improvement of composite manufacturing and repair processes.
